Do This Now (5 Steps)

  1. Pick one question. Every week, choose one product question that keeps you up at night. Write it down. Keep it short.
  1. Open your data. Pull one metric that relates to that question. Don't overthink it—start with something simple like trial-to-paid conversion or support ticket volume.
  1. Look for a shift. Compare this week's number to last week's. If it moved more than 10%, ask why. If it didn't, ask why not.
  1. Write one sentence. What does this number tell you about your customers? No jargon. Just plain English.
  1. Share it. Send that sentence to your team in Slack or email. No meeting needed. Just a single insight that makes everyone smarter.

Avoid These Traps

  • Don't try to answer everything. One question per week is enough. More than that and you'll drown in analysis.
  • Don't ignore small signals. A 3% drop might be noise, but if it happens three weeks in a row, it's a pattern.
  • Don't skip the ritual. If you miss a week, you lose the habit. Set a recurring calendar invite and treat it like a meeting with your CEO.
  • Don't confuse data with decisions. The number is just a clue. Your job is to decide what to do next.
  • Don't go it alone. Bring your ops lead or a teammate. Two brains catch more blind spots.
